Double Cup Final Joy for Youth Academy
The success of the Winchester City Academy, sponsored by Dessports, has been continued, and both the U18s and U16s have Cup Finals to look forward to later in the season, both sides having reached the finals of their respective League Cups.
Club chairman, Derek Caws, said "Our Academy sides have a great record of winning things, and we are delighted that both teams are fighting to fill our trophy cabinet again this year. The Youth Academy is a vital part of our plans to develop the football club. We are pleased to see the lads winning things, but it's also great to see so many young players competing for places in the Reserves and First Team. This can only be a good thing for the future of the football club. As a club, we are committed to developing our youth players and giving them their chance to compete in the senior teams - and beyond. Look at Chris Flood, who played for our U18s and First Team last season, and has now earned himself a professional contract at Brentford FC."

The U18s Cup Final will take place on Sunday 13th April at 2.00 PM
Venue: Privett Park, Gosport
Winchester City U18s V Moneyfields
The U16s Cup Final will take place on Monday 5th May at 10.30 AM
Venue: Gangwarily, Blackfield and Langley
Winchester City U16s V AFC Totton
